1 clinic specializing in Vascular surgery providing treatment of Mesenteric ischemia Mesenteric ischemia is a condition where blood flow to the intestines is reduced or blocked, leading to tissue damage. It causes severe abdominal pain, often occurring after eating, and can be life-threatening if not treated promptly. disease in Tijuana.
